Comparison Summary

Let's dive into a comprehensive comparison of the Samsung Galaxy A04e and the Asus ROG Phone 8. These two phones occupy distinct segments of the market, catering to vastly different user needs and priorities.

1. Specifications Breakdown

FeatureSamsung Galaxy A04eAsus ROG Phone 8Real-World Implications
Design
Dimensions (mm)164.2 x 75.9 x 9.1163.8 x 76.8 x 8.9A04e is slightly taller and wider; both are relatively slim. ROG Phone 8 might feel slightly denser due to higher weight.
Weight (g)188225A04e is significantly lighter, making it more comfortable for extended use and one-handed operation. ROG Phone 8's weight suggests premium materials
Display
TypePLS LCDLTPO AMOLEDROG Phone 8 offers superior contrast, vibrant colors, and power efficiency due to AMOLED technology.
Size6.5"6.78"ROG Phone 8 provides a larger screen for immersive content consumption.
Resolution720 x 16001080 x 2400ROG Phone 8 boasts much sharper visuals due to higher resolution. A04e's lower resolution might appear pixelated to some users.
Refresh RateN/A165HzROG Phone 8's high refresh rate delivers incredibly smooth animations and scrolling, especially beneficial for gaming and fast-paced content.
Performance
ChipsetHelio P35Snapdragon 8 Gen 3ROG Phone 8 offers vastly superior processing power, enabling seamless multitasking, demanding gaming, and smooth performance across all tasks.
CPUOcta-core 2.3 GHzOcta-core 3.3 GHzROG Phone 8's higher clock speeds and advanced architecture translate to significantly faster performance.
RAM3GB/4GB12GB/16GBROG Phone 8 provides substantially more RAM, allowing for effortless multitasking and smooth handling of demanding applications.
Camera
Main Camera13MP50MPROG Phone 8's higher resolution main camera likely captures more detail and offers better low-light performance.
Video Recording1080p@30fps8K@24fpsROG Phone 8 supports significantly higher video resolution and frame rates, ideal for content creators and enthusiasts.
Battery Life
Capacity5000 mAh5500 mAhBoth phones offer large battery capacities, but real-world battery life depends on usage patterns and software optimization.

2. Key Insights

The Samsung Galaxy A04e is a budget-friendly smartphone designed for basic tasks like calling, texting, and web browsing. Its strengths lie in its affordability and long battery life. However, its performance is limited, and the display quality is subpar compared to modern standards.

The Asus ROG Phone 8, on the other hand, is a premium gaming smartphone packed with cutting-edge technology. It excels in performance, display quality, and gaming features. The high refresh rate screen, powerful processor, and ample RAM ensure a smooth and responsive experience. However, this performance comes at a significantly higher price point.

3. User Profiles and Recommendations

The A04e is ideal for users on a tight budget who prioritize basic functionality and long battery life. It's a suitable option for seniors, students, or anyone who primarily uses their phone for communication and light web browsing.

The ROG Phone 8 is perfect for gamers, power users, and content creators who demand top-tier performance and a premium mobile experience. Its advanced features justify the higher price for users who will fully utilize its capabilities.
